14_面向对象_01_2 完整格式

这是全部过程:不可以减少

package com.zuoye;
public class Zuoye4 { /*需求:定义一个People类,有姓名、身高、体重三个属性,有一个方法是判断肥胖, 启动程序给三个三个学生分别赋值姓名、身高、体重,依据赋值的体重和身高分别判断三位同学的身材, 最后输出三位同学的身材情况,输入内容格式为:xx同学,你的身材标准/偏胖/偏瘦。*/ // 成员变量
   private String name; private double height; private double weight; //构造方法 public Zuoye4(){
   } //构造方法
public Zuoye4(String name,double height,double weight) { this.name = name; this.height = height; this.weight = weight; }
//成员方法
public String getName() { 
return name;
}
public void setName(String name) {
this.name = name;
}

public double getHeight() {
return height;
}

public void setHeight(double height) {
this.height = height;
}

public double getWeight() {
return weight;
}

public void setWeight(double weight) {
this.weight = weight;
}
//成员方法
public void feipang(String name,double height,double weight){
if (height/weight >= 3.5) { System.out.println("你太瘦了");
}
else if ( 3 < height/weight&&height/weight < 3.5) {
System.
out.println("你正正好");
}
else if ( 3 >= height/weight ) {
System.
out.println("你太瘦了");
}
}
//主程序(可以实现外调直接用方法名就可以,这里用的是feipang) 基本都不能动,除了(args)之外,其他都不能动
: public static void main(String[] args)
public static void main(String[] args) {
//构建一个Refrigerator对象
Zuoye4 zuoye4
= new Zuoye4();
//调用点调 输入值 可以在这里更改值,就可以改变输出值
zuoye4.feipang(
"小乔", 163, 52);
}
}

 

posted @ 2020-10-28 16:48  wajueji  阅读(112)  评论(0编辑  收藏  举报